Transaction cd75af0686ef5be56039e90ea2f3c05eddaf900f0c3f4a5158282c79ca875c7a

block
a20fabebd109d2d63e09b3a598c1021c934a9d2eab65d0491fb62e76f3b45c18

10 Inputs

2 Outputs